Hillary Rodham Clinton's doubts about big foreign trade deals came only in the heat of the presidential campaign, Democratic rival Barack Obama said Tuesday, addressing labor leaders who strongly oppose many of the agreements. [snip]
"So, when a candidate rails against NAFTA today, it's fair to ask her where she was with NAFTA 20 years ago," said Obama. "You don't just suddenly wake up and say NAFTA is a terrible thing when you were for it before."
Obama made his case at a regional convention of the United Auto Workers just a day after Clinton used the same forum to call for a "time out" on new trade deals while their impact on American jobs is assessed.
